Кто-нибудь знает, есть ли быстрый способ получить все записи в таблице с помощью Doctrine без использования DQL.
Я что-то пропустил или вам просто нужно было написать публичную функцию в классе?
Если у вас есть класс сущностей ( Руководство по хранилищу доктрин ):
$records = $em->getRepository("Entities\YourTargetEntity")->findAll();
Если у вас нет класса сущности ( Руководство по PDO ):
$pdo = $em->getCurrentConnection()->getDbh(); $result = $pdo->query("select * from table"); //plain sql query here, it's just PDO $records = $pdo->fetchAll();